Transaction

4c3034c7f4c99e2676e332f753372d8da11d571ad837a3fd831f9e55f30e1863

Summary

In Block138153
TimeWed, 12 Apr 2023 15:27:45 UTC
Total Input928.6083037 Nebula
Total Output983.6083037 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
825427 Confirmations983.6083037 Nebula
Raw Transaction